Sixteen keepers in 10 seasons – Paul Jewell knows what his No.1 priority is
IPSWICH Town manager Paul Jewell is in no doubt what his number one priority is this summer.
The Blues boss has used four different goalkeepers this season, taking the tally of custodians used by the club over the last 10 years to an incredible 16.
David Stockdale (Fulham) and Alex McCarthy (Reading) have both seen loan spells cut short by their parent clubs, while veteran Richard Wright has made just one appearance since signing a short-term deal until the end of the campaign.
And it would appear that Jewell is uncertain about Arran Lee-Barrett, with the 28-year-old’s longest run in the side just five games this season.
“It’s been a tough one,” said Jewell, when quizzed about his chopping and changing of keepers.
“We’ve been at the mercy of other people this year.
“It’s galling enough when your own player gets injured, but when a player gets injured elsewhere and it means you lose a loan player it’s frustrating. It’s certainly not been ideal having two loan keepers.

“We want to go with a permanent keeper next year, or if it’s a loan, we don’t want that 24-hour recall. We are looking for players in that position.”
With Kelvin Davis the only goalkeeper to make more than 40 appearances for Town in consecutive seasons over the last decade (see inside for full breakdown), Jewell continued: “If a general football fan was asked ‘who’s Ipswich’s goalie?’ in recent years then I doubt anyone would have immediately sprung to mind.
“Richard Wright was always a name which people knew, but in recent years we’ve had Lewis Price, Arran (Lee-Barrett), (Shane) Supple, Brian Murphy, the list goes on. By contrast we all know who West Ham’s goalie is, or Reading’s, for example.
“We want to get to stage where our goalkeeper is recognised and he’s an established No.1.”
COUNTING THE CUSTODIANS
02/03
Andy Marshall 50 starts
Paul Gerrard 5 (loan)
James Pullen 2
03/04
Kelvin Davis 51
Lewis Price 1
04/05
Kelvin Davis 42
Lewis Price 9+1
05/06
Lewis Price 26
Shane Supple 22+1
06/07
Lewis Price 38
Shane Supple 12+1
Mike Pollitt 1 (loan)
07/08
Neil Alexander 31
Stephen Bywater 17 (loan)
08/09
Richard Wright 50
Shane Supple 1
09/10
Brian Murphy 16
Arran Lee-Barrett 14+1
Richard Wright 13
Asmir Begovic 6 (loan)
Supple 1
10/11
Marton Fulop 38
Brian Murphy 9
Arran Lee-Barrett 7
11/12
David Stockdale 18 (loan)
Arran Lee-Barrett 13+1
Alex McCarthy 10 (loan)
Richard Wright 1
